xm
2024-06-14 722af26bc6fec32bb289b1df51a9016a4935610f
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
Êþº¾4s
!?@
?    AB
CD
?
E     F
GHIJ
K
LM
N€
OP
?Q
GR ST
UV
?WXYÿÿÿZ[ xssProperties2Lcom/dl/framework/config/properties/XssProperties;RuntimeVisibleAnnotations8Lorg/springframework/beans/factory/annotation/Autowired;<init>()VCodeLineNumberTableLocalVariableTablethis&Lcom/dl/framework/config/FilterConfig;xssFilterRegistration?()Lorg/springframework/boot/web/servlet/FilterRegistrationBean; registration=Lorg/springframework/boot/web/servlet/FilterRegistrationBean;initParametersLjava/util/Map;LocalVariableTypeTable5Ljava/util/Map<Ljava/lang/String;Ljava/lang/String;>;-Lorg/springframework/context/annotation/Bean;HLorg/springframework/boot/autoconfigure/condition/ConditionalOnProperty;value xss.enabled havingValuetruesomeFilterRegistration
SourceFileFilterConfig.java6Lorg/springframework/context/annotation/Configuration; &';org/springframework/boot/web/servlet/FilterRegistrationBean \]javax/servlet/DispatcherType ^_com/dl/common/filter/XssFilter `a "#b cdcom/dl/common/utils/StringUtils, ef gh    xssFilter ij kljava/util/HashMapexcludes mdn op qr%com/dl/common/filter/RepeatableFilterjava/lang/String/*repeatableFilter$com/dl/framework/config/FilterConfigjava/lang/ObjectREQUESTLjavax/servlet/DispatcherType;setDispatcherTypes@(Ljavax/servlet/DispatcherType;[Ljavax/servlet/DispatcherType;)V    setFilter(Ljavax/servlet/Filter;)V0com/dl/framework/config/properties/XssPropertiesgetUrlPatterns()Ljava/lang/String;split9(Ljava/lang/String;Ljava/lang/String;)[Ljava/lang/String;addUrlPatterns([Ljava/lang/String;)VsetName(Ljava/lang/String;)VsetOrder(I)V getExcludes java/util/Mapput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;setInitParameters(Ljava/util/Map;)V! !"#$%&'(/*·±)* +,-.(ÍY»Y·L+²½¶+»Y·¶    +*´
¶  ¸¶+¶+¶»Y·M,*´
¶¹W+,¶+°)*
 !"#.$4%:&B'R(W)* Y+,Q/0B123 B14$567[s89s:;.(v.»Y·L+»Y·¶    +½YS¶+¶+¶+°)/01 2&3,4*.+,&/0$5<=$>